Scope and Contents From the Collection: Diaries. 1929-1951. 1 linear foot. James V. Bennett began his diaries in 1929, and continued making entries on a regular basis until his death in 1951. The earliest diaries were Bennett's daily records of weather as related to dryland farming in Daniels County; financial accounts; ranching operations; maintenance of farm equipment; wheat, barley, and rye market futures; his stock market investments; and miscellany.
